Just thinking about converting PDFs to EPUB brings various software to mind! If you’re looking for something user-friendly, Calibre is definitely the way to go. You get a solid interface and can handle large batches without losing your sanity navigating through options. I appreciate how organized it keeps your library too. It transforms your files quickly and accurately, which is super important!

If you want something more professional, there’s Adobe Acrobat Pro. It's very reliable and provides an array of editing tools that come in handy. Format retention is usually on point, although I admit it's a bit heavier on the wallet.

For a casual approach, I’ve also turned to online converters like Smallpdf. It’s fast—just upload and get your file! The faster the process, the better, especially if you are in a rush. The tool takes the worry away while maintaining pretty decent quality. Each of these options makes my life easier in different ways and keeps my reading material diverse and accessible.

The world of file conversion has grown so much that there are a ton of software tools out there for converting PDF to EPUB files! One popular option I’ve come across is Calibre. It’s free and open-source, perfect for managing and converting eBooks. What I love about Calibre is its user-friendly interface; you can drag and drop your PDFs, choose the conversion settings, and boom, you’ve got an EPUB ready for eReaders like Kindle or Nook.

Another great tool is Adobe Acrobat Pro, although it’s a bit more on the pricey side. If you’re not pressed for budget, it offers tons of features, including the ability to convert files easily with a slick design. I find that with Adobe, you get a lot of control over the layout and formatting. There’s also an online option, Zamzar, which is straightforward since you just upload your PDF, select EPUB, and receive your file via email. It’s perfect for quick conversions when you need it!

Of course, there’s also the option of using online services like Convertio. Just upload your PDF, click convert, and you’ll get your EPUB file within moments. It’s super practical, especially when you’re on the go.

In the end, I guess it all boils down to preference. Each tool has its own flare, but I personally keep going back to Calibre for its all-in-one library management functionalities! Overall, these tools make reading much more flexible, and who doesn’t want that?

Which software can convert pdf file to epub easily?

4 Answers2025-06-05 02:20:03
I’ve tested a ton of tools, and 'Calibre' is hands down the best. It’s free, open-source, and super versatile—not just for PDF to EPUB but for managing your entire digital library. The conversion isn’t always perfect, especially if the PDF is image-heavy, but tweaking the settings helps. For simpler files, 'OnlineConvert' is a quick web-based alternative, though I prefer offline tools for privacy. Another underrated option is 'Pandoc', a command-line tool that’s powerful if you’re tech-savvy. For polished results, 'ABBYY FineReader' does OCR well, but it’s pricey. If you need batch conversions, 'PDFelement' is reliable, with a clean interface. Avoid random online converters—they often mess up formatting or worse, steal your data. Stick to trusted names, and always preview the output before finalizing.

What are the steps to convert a pdf to epub free using software?

4 Answers2025-08-03 13:38:12
Converting PDF to EPUB for free is something I do often to read on my e-reader. The best tool I've found is Calibre, which is open-source and packed with features. First, download and install Calibre from its official website. Once installed, open the software and click 'Add Books' to import your PDF file. After the file is loaded, select it and click 'Convert Books'. In the conversion dialog, choose 'EPUB' as the output format. You can tweak settings like margins or font size under the 'Page Setup' and 'Look & Feel' tabs if needed. Finally, hit 'OK' to start the conversion. The process might take a few minutes depending on the file size. Once done, you’ll find the EPUB version in your Calibre library. Another great option is online tools like Zamzar or Online-Convert, but I prefer Calibre because it’s more reliable and doesn’t require uploading sensitive documents to the cloud. For complicated PDFs with lots of images or formatting, you might need to adjust settings or even use OCR software like ABBYY FineReader if the text isn’t selectable. Always preview the EPUB afterward to ensure the formatting looks right.

What tools can I use to transform PDF to EPUB?

3 Answers2025-10-31 00:02:41
In the digital age, converting PDFs to EPUB formats is a necessity for many readers, especially those who prefer eBooks or reading on their devices. One awesome tool I’ve used is Calibre. This desktop application is a powerhouse! Not only can it convert PDF files into EPUB, but it also manages your eBook library, letting you edit metadata, download news, and sync with eReaders. The user interface is quite friendly too, so you can easily navigate through its various features without feeling overwhelmed. You just upload your PDF, choose EPUB as the output format, and hit convert—it’s that simple! Plus, the output quality is generally pretty good, though some formatting can sometimes go a little haywire depending on the original file. Then there’s Adobe Acrobat, which is pretty much the industry standard for PDF manipulation. If you’re already using it, converting a PDF to EPUB can be quite straightforward, especially if you've got a subscription. Just open the PDF, go to ‘Export PDF’, choose EPUB as the format, and voila! However, it’s a bit pricier for those who might be looking for a free solution. Lastly, online tools like Zamzar and Online-Convert are great for quick conversions on the go. They’re accessible from any device and don’t require you to install anything. Just upload your PDF, select EPUB, and download the converted file. This is a perfect option if you're just looking for something quick and easy! As great as all these options are, I’ve found that it’s always a good idea to review the converted file, just to catch any formatting oddities that might pop up.
